K added to 10 gives you 4 times the value of K.
If you wanted to solve the expression:
Subtract both sides of the expression, right hand side(10+k) and left hand side(4K), by -k as you want to get rid of the variable to get simply 10 on the LHS.
10+k -k = 4k -k
If we want to subtract k from k then we get 0, and if we want to subtract k from 4k we get 3k. For the sake of simplicity think of k as an object saying if I subtract object A from object A I get zero, and so forth.
We are left with the expression:
10 = 3k
We divide both sides by 3 as to get rid of it from the RHS.
We get a solution 10/3 = k
